Understanding Scleroderma and Its Impact on Joints

Scleroderma is a complex autoimmune disease characterized by abnormal thickening and hardening of the skin and connective tissues. This condition doesn’t just affect the skin; it can involve internal organs and the musculoskeletal system, including the joints. The question “Does Scleroderma Cause Joint Pain?” is critical because joint discomfort is one of the most common complaints among those diagnosed with this disorder.

Joint pain in scleroderma arises primarily from inflammation in the synovium—the lining of joints—and from fibrosis, which causes stiffening of connective tissues around joints. This combination can severely limit mobility and reduce quality of life. Patients often describe joint pain as aching or stiffness, which may worsen with activity or during flare-ups.

The Pathophysiology Behind Joint Pain in Scleroderma

Scleroderma triggers an overactive immune response that leads to excessive collagen deposition in the skin and internal tissues. This fibrosis extends to tendons, ligaments, and joint capsules. As collagen accumulates, it causes these structures to thicken and lose elasticity.

Simultaneously, immune-mediated inflammation targets synovial membranes, causing swelling and pain. This inflammatory process resembles what happens in other autoimmune conditions like rheumatoid arthritis but tends to be less aggressive in scleroderma.

The combined effect of fibrosis and inflammation leads to:

    • Joint stiffness especially in fingers, wrists, knees, and ankles.
    • Reduced range of motion due to tightening of surrounding tissues.
    • Swelling or tenderness around affected joints.

This interplay explains why joint pain is a hallmark symptom for many scleroderma patients.

Common Joints Affected by Scleroderma-Related Pain

Joint involvement varies widely among individuals with scleroderma. The most frequently affected sites include:

    • Fingers: Raynaud’s phenomenon often accompanies scleroderma causing poor blood flow; combined with joint fibrosis, this results in painful stiffness.
    • Wrists: Tendon friction and capsule thickening contribute to discomfort and limited movement.
    • Knees: Large weight-bearing joints may suffer from inflammatory arthritis-like symptoms.
    • Ankles: Swelling and limited flexibility are common complaints here.

The severity of joint pain can fluctuate over time. Some patients experience persistent mild discomfort while others endure intense flare-ups that mimic rheumatoid arthritis.

The Role of Inflammatory Arthritis in Scleroderma

Some individuals with scleroderma develop overlapping conditions such as inflammatory arthritis. This subset experiences more pronounced joint swelling, warmth, and prolonged morning stiffness lasting over an hour.

Inflammatory arthritis within scleroderma is often seronegative—meaning typical rheumatoid factors are absent—making diagnosis challenging. However, imaging studies like ultrasound or MRI frequently reveal synovitis (inflammation of the synovial membrane).

Identifying this inflammatory component is crucial because it guides treatment decisions aimed at reducing immune activity and preventing joint damage.

How Does Joint Pain Manifest Clinically?

Joint pain associated with scleroderma presents with several distinctive features:

    • Pain Quality: Usually described as dull aching or throbbing rather than sharp or shooting.
    • Stiffness: Particularly noticeable after periods of inactivity such as waking up or sitting for long durations.
    • Swelling: Mild to moderate swelling may be evident but rarely as pronounced as seen in classic rheumatoid arthritis.
    • Limited Range of Motion: Patients often report difficulty fully bending or straightening affected joints.

These symptoms can interfere with daily tasks like buttoning clothes or walking comfortably. Over time, chronic fibrosis can lead to permanent contractures—fixed deformities that severely restrict function.

Differentiating Scleroderma Joint Pain from Other Causes

Because joint pain is a common symptom across numerous diseases, distinguishing scleroderma-related arthralgia from other causes is essential.

Key differentiators include:

    • Lack of erosions on X-rays: Unlike rheumatoid arthritis that causes bone erosion, scleroderma typically shows no or minimal joint erosions.
    • Skin changes: Thickened skin overlying painful joints strongly suggests scleroderma involvement.
    • Raynaud’s phenomenon presence: Cold-induced color changes in fingers often coexist with scleroderma-related joint symptoms.
    • Autoantibody profile: Specific antibodies like anti-centromere or anti-Scl-70 help confirm diagnosis.

A careful clinical examination supplemented by laboratory tests helps clinicians pinpoint the exact cause behind joint discomfort.

Treatment Strategies for Joint Pain in Scleroderma

Managing joint pain caused by scleroderma requires a multifaceted approach tailored to individual needs. The goal is to alleviate symptoms while preserving joint function.

Medications

Medication Type Purpose Common Examples
NSAIDs (Nonsteroidal Anti-Inflammatory Drugs) Reduce mild-to-moderate inflammation and pain relief Ibuprofen, Naproxen
Corticosteroids (Low Dose) Suppress immune response during flare-ups; reduce synovitis Prednisone (low dose)
Disease-Modifying Antirheumatic Drugs (DMARDs) Treat underlying autoimmune activity; prevent progression Methotrexate, Mycophenolate mofetil
Pain Relievers/Analgesics Pain control without anti-inflammatory effects Acetaminophen (Tylenol)

NSAIDs are usually first-line for mild symptoms but must be used cautiously given potential kidney involvement in scleroderma patients. Low-dose corticosteroids are effective but long-term use risks skin thinning and worsening fibrosis.

DMARDs like methotrexate have shown promise in reducing joint inflammation and improving function but require close monitoring for side effects.

Physical Therapy & Lifestyle Modifications

Physical therapy plays an indispensable role by focusing on:

    • Range-of-motion exercises: Prevent contractures and maintain flexibility.
    • Strength training: Support muscles surrounding joints for better stability.
    • Pain management techniques: Heat application or gentle massage can soothe aching joints.

Lifestyle changes such as avoiding repetitive strain on affected joints, using assistive devices (e.g., splints), and pacing activities help reduce flare-ups.

The Prognosis: What To Expect Over Time?

Joint symptoms in scleroderma vary widely from person to person. For some, arthralgia remains mild without significant impairment. Others face progressive stiffness that limits hand use or walking ability.

While scleroderma rarely causes destructive arthritis like rheumatoid arthritis does, chronic fibrosis can nonetheless lead to permanent disability if untreated. Early recognition and intervention improve outcomes dramatically.

Regular follow-up with rheumatologists ensures timely adjustments in therapy based on symptom progression or new complications.

The Importance of Early Diagnosis for Joint Symptoms

Detecting joint involvement early means patients can receive treatments aimed at controlling inflammation before irreversible damage occurs. Since many people initially present with vague symptoms such as finger stiffness or mild swelling alongside skin changes, awareness among healthcare providers is crucial.

Blood tests looking for specific autoantibodies combined with imaging studies help confirm diagnosis quickly so therapy can start without delay.
